Seminar: ACRC Workshop
Spiking in Brains and Machines
The human brain remains one of the most remarkable computing systems ever discovered—capable of extraordinary efficiency, adaptability, and intelligence while consuming only a fraction of the energy required by today’s AI systems.
What principles enable such performance, and how can they inspire the next generation of computing architectures?
This one-day workshop, “Spiking in Brains and Machines,” will explore these questions by connecting insights from computational neuroscience, dynamical systems, artificial intelligence, and computer architecture.
Participants will gain an integrated understanding of the principles underlying spiking neural activity and how these biological mechanisms can inspire fundamentally new approaches to computation and AI.
Throughout the day, Dr. Eugene Izhikevich will present the scientific foundations of spiking neurons and neural computation, based on his landmark book, Dynamical Systems in Neuroscience: The Geometry of Excitability and Bursting, before presenting his latest vision for translating these concepts into future computing architectures, as described in his Spiking Manifesto.
Together, these complementary perspectives demonstrate how ideas originating in neuroscience may shape the future of machine intelligence, creating new opportunities for interdisciplinary research and technological innovation.
The workshop will conclude with an interactive panel discussion featuring leading researchers from both academia and industry, focusing on emerging research directions, open scientific challenges, and opportunities for future collaboration in neuromorphic computing, AI hardware, and brain-inspired architectures.
Designed for researchers, graduate students, and engineers from both academia and industry, this workshop offers a unique opportunity to engage with one of the pioneers of computational neuroscience and explore how biology and engineering can jointly influence the future of intelligent computing.
